============================================================================ Ubuntu Security Notice USN-2209-1 May 07, 2014 libvirt vulnerabilities ============================================================================ A security issue affects these releases of Ubuntu and its derivatives: - Ubuntu 13.10 Summary: Several security issues were fixed in libvirt. Software Description: - libvirt: Libvirt virtualization toolkit Details: It was discovered that libvirt incorrectly handled symlinks when using the LXC driver. An attacker could possibly use this issue to delete host devices, create arbitrary nodes, and shutdown or power off the host. (CVE-2013-6456) Marian Krcmarik discovered that libvirt incorrectly handled seamless SPICE migrations. An attacker could possibly use this issue to cause a denial of service. (CVE-2013-7336) Update instructions: The problem can be corrected by updating your system to the following package versions: Ubuntu 13.10: libvirt-bin 1.1.1-0ubuntu8.11 libvirt0 1.1.1-0ubuntu8.11 After a standard system update you need to reboot your computer to make all the necessary changes.
